You're invited to join us at The Knox Pub, in Bilton on Wednesday 26th March at 6.30-9.00pm.
David Francis, artisan baker for 40 years, will be sharing some of his passion & expertise in natural sourdough breadmaking, and how the gospel of Jesus is revealed through this process. We'll take part in hand milling the grain, dough making, starter creation & care, PLUS of course, your dough to take home and bake the next day. (recipe & methods will be sent in pdf format)
Light refreshments will be available - tea, coffee, plus fresh bread & butter of course!
(The pub have said there will be preferential beer prices for those wanting to use beer to add to their dough mix)
We'll provide: the flour, salt and starter
Please bring: a plastic bowl that holds around two litres of water, a jug and, if possible, a digital set of scales that measures in 1g increments.
Please sign up to let us know you're coming, to help with providing all the necessary ingredients - and let us know if you don't have the bowl or scales (we will bring spares).
